Why do we need more typefaces?

Now23 ✚
This is the 1st or 2nd most common question I heard in the last 16 years, since I announced: “I’m going to draw fonts!”. It's a tricky question. I could give you an easy answer: why so many songs, TV shows, yoghurt flavors? But in this talk I am going to try to answer this question on a deeper level. After a short analysis of a newsletter from October 1933 that argues around this topic, I will take you on a journey that introduces five reasons for developing more typefaces.

With two MAs in Graphic and Type Design (Esad Type 2011), Damien has devoted most of his education to exploring the science of reading, aesthetics and the history of visual arts. He has spent the last decade directing type projects and working with leading agencies such as Interbrand, FutureBrand, Leo Burnett, Jones Knowles Ritchie and Red Bee on some of the world’s most iconic brands and rebrands. Prior to joining Monotype as Creative Type Director, Damien worked at font foundry Dalton Maag in London, where his role progressed from Type Designer to Head of Font Development, leading a team of thirty type designers and font engineers. His experience spans calligraphy, type design, font engineering and screen optimization. At Monotype, Damien works with agencies, foundries and brands to empower creatives to build and express authentic voices through type.
